Trojan.MulDrop28.55337

Added to the Dr.Web virus database: 2024-12-25

Virus description added:

Technical Information

To ensure autorun and distribution
Sets the following service settings
  • [HKLM\System\CurrentControlSet\Services\MagiskQvmSvc_1082678] 'ImagePath' = 'cmd /c start sc create CleverSoar displayname= CleverSoar binPath= "%ProgramFiles(x86)%\Windows NT\tProtect.dll" typ...
  • [HKLM\System\CurrentControlSet\Services\CleverSoar] 'Start' = '00000002'
  • [HKLM\System\CurrentControlSet\Services\CleverSoar] 'ImagePath' = '%ProgramFiles(x86)%\Windows NT\tProtect.dll'
  • [HKLM\System\CurrentControlSet\Services\MagiskQvmSvc_1088216] 'ImagePath' = 'cmd /c start sc start CleverSoar'
  • [HKLM\System\CurrentControlSet\Services\MagiskQvmSvc_1092771] 'ImagePath' = 'cmd /c start sc start CleverSoar'
  • [HKLM\System\CurrentControlSet\Services\MagiskQvmSvc_1094487] 'ImagePath' = 'cmd /c start sc start CleverSoar'
Creates the following services
  • 'MagiskQvmSvc_1082678' cmd /c start sc create CleverSoar displayname= CleverSoar binPath= "%ProgramFiles(x86)%\Windows NT\tProtect.dll" type= kernel start= auto
  • 'CleverSoar' %ProgramFiles(x86)%\Windows NT\tProtect.dll
  • 'MagiskQvmSvc_1088216' cmd /c start sc start CleverSoar
  • 'MagiskQvmSvc_1092771' cmd /c start sc start CleverSoar
  • 'MagiskQvmSvc_1094487' cmd /c start sc start CleverSoar
Malicious functions
To complicate detection of its presence in the operating system,
adds antivirus exclusion:
  • '<SYSTEM32>\windowspowershell\v1.0\powershell.exe' -Command "Add-MpPreference -ExclusionPath 'C:\'"
Terminates or attempts to terminate
the following system processes:
  • <SYSTEM32>\cmd.exe

Miscellaneous
Creates and executes the following
  • '%TEMP%\is-pfnfc.tmp\<File name>.tmp' /SL5="$50244,7367538,845824,<Full path to file>"
  • '%TEMP%\is-63uqa.tmp\<File name>.tmp' /SL5="$701A4,7367538,845824,<Full path to file>" /VERYSILENT
  • '%ProgramFiles(x86)%\windows nt\7zr.exe' x -y res.dat -pad8dtyw9eyfd9aslyd9iald
  • '%ProgramFiles(x86)%\windows nt\7zr.exe' x -y locale7.dat -pasfasdf79yf9layslofs
  • '%ProgramFiles(x86)%\windows nt\7zr.exe' x -y -bd locale.dat -pfhliafyaiofyaif
Restarts the analyzed sample
Executes the following
  • '<SYSTEM32>\schtasks.exe' /create /tn "turminoob" /xml "%ProgramFiles(x86)%\Windows NT\task.xml"
  • '<SYSTEM32>\cmd.exe' /c start reg add "H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\Schedule\TaskCache\Tree\turminoob" /v Index /t REG_DWORD /d 0 /f
  • '%WINDIR%\syswow64\schtasks.exe' /Run /TN "\PayloadTask1"
  • '%WINDIR%\syswow64\schtasks.exe' /Create /F /TN "\PayloadTask1" /RU "user" /RL HIGHEST /SC ONCE /ST 00:00 /TR "\"C:\\Program Files (x86)\\Windows NT\\winnt.exe\""
  • '<SYSTEM32>\reg.exe' delete "H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\Schedule\TaskCache\Tree\turminoob" /v SD /f
  • '<SYSTEM32>\cmd.exe' /c start reg delete "H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\Schedule\TaskCache\Tree\turminoob" /v SD /f
  • '<SYSTEM32>\reg.exe' add "H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\Schedule\TaskCache\Tree\turminoob" /v Index /t REG_DWORD /d 0 /f
  • '%WINDIR%\syswow64\cmd.exe' /q /c 7zr.exe x -y -bd locale.dat -pfhliafyaiofyaif > NUL 2>&1
  • '%WINDIR%\syswow64\cmd.exe' /q /c SCHTASKS /Create /F /TN "\PayloadTask1" /RU "user" /RL HIGHEST /SC ONCE /ST 00:00 /TR "\"C:\\Program Files (x86)\\Windows NT\\winnt.exe\"" & SCHTASKS /Run /TN "\PayloadTask1" & schtasks /...
  • '<SYSTEM32>\taskeng.exe' {D7549EE4-B85D-45E5-B957-2236CE1DF461} S-1-5-21-3691498038-2086406363-2140527554-1000:ebxgsonfpf\user:Interactive:[1]
  • '<SYSTEM32>\sc.exe' start CleverSoar
  • '<SYSTEM32>\cmd.exe' /c start sc start CleverSoar
  • '<SYSTEM32>\sc.exe' create CleverSoar displayname= CleverSoar binPath= "%ProgramFiles(x86)%\Windows NT\tProtect.dll" type= kernel start= auto
  • '<SYSTEM32>\cmd.exe' /c start sc create CleverSoar displayname= CleverSoar binPath= "%ProgramFiles(x86)%\Windows NT\tProtect.dll" type= kernel start= auto
  • '<SYSTEM32>\cmd.exe' /c start schtasks /create /tn "turminoob" /xml "%ProgramFiles(x86)%\Windows NT\task.xml"
  • '%WINDIR%\syswow64\schtasks.exe' /Delete /TN "\PayloadTask1" /F
  • '%ProgramFiles(x86)%\windows nt\7zr.exe' x -y locale7.dat -pasfasdf79yf9layslofs' (with hidden window)
  • '%ProgramFiles(x86)%\windows nt\7zr.exe' x -y res.dat -pad8dtyw9eyfd9aslyd9iald' (with hidden window)
  • '%WINDIR%\syswow64\cmd.exe' /q /c 7zr.exe x -y -bd locale.dat -pfhliafyaiofyaif > NUL 2>&1' (with hidden window)
  • '%WINDIR%\syswow64\cmd.exe' /q /c SCHTASKS /Create /F /TN "\PayloadTask1" /RU "user" /RL HIGHEST /SC ONCE /ST 00:00 /TR "\"C:\\Program Files (x86)\\Windows NT\\winnt.exe\"" & SCHTASKS /Run /TN "\PayloadTask1" & schtasks /...' (with hidden window)
  • '<SYSTEM32>\windowspowershell\v1.0\powershell.exe' -Command "Add-MpPreference -ExclusionPath 'C:\'"' (with hidden window)
